For annual meeting of the Bulgaria Chapter of MCAA

 

The annual meeting of Bulgaria Chapter of the Marie Curie Alumni Association will take place on October 19th 2018,

in the Main Conference Hall of the Faculty of chemistry and pharmacy – Sofia University, “James Bourchier” blvd. -1, Sofia-1164

After-meeting social event will take place in a nearby restaurant, which is cost-free for registered members of BG-Chapter of MCAA. There is a possibility to reimburse travel and accommodation costs for the MCAA members not resident in Sofia.

All members of BG-Chapter of MCAA that are currently abroad are welcome to take part in the meeting through on-line communication platforms.
